I want to use the maritime coastal town where I live, Tramore, as an illustration of what dereliction looks like. We have two derelict hotels - the Grand Hotel and the Tramore Hotel. The Grand Hotel has been derelict for more than eight years, since 2016, and the Tramore Hotel has been derelict for many more years. There has been a loss of 100 rooms between the two hotels for a period of at least eight years. I have done a back-of-an-envelope calculation of the cost of the loss of bed nights and the loss to the economy of Tramore as a result of those two derelictions. I estimate that there has been a loss, in the form of visitor numbers and the ancillary spin-off to other businesses, of €90 million since 2016. No small maritime holiday town can afford losses of that magnitude. That is what dereliction looks like and what it does to communities, town and small economies.
